Mass of an object m = 5 kg. Velocity of that object v = 1.2 m/s. We need to find the momentum of an object. It is equal to the product of mass and its velocity. Mathematically it is given by : p = m v. p = 6 kg-m/s. So the momentum of an object is 6 kg-m/s. Hence this is the required solution.
